Can Jakub Vrana make the roster?

The Caps made an interesting move at the end of the summertime as they signed Jakub Vrana to a PTO. NHL.com writes this about him

"The 28 year old had six points (two goals, four assists) in 21 games for the Blues last season. Vrana has 209 points (110 goals, 99 assists) in 367 regular season games for the Blues, Red Wings and Capitals and eight points (three goals, five assists) in 38 playoff games. He won the Cup with the Capitals in 2018"
NHL.com

He's been a journeyman since the trade for Anthony Mantha and now that Mantha got traded at the trade deadline it was a smart move by Chris Patrick to scoop V right back up. Every player needs a chance to succeed and V has shown he can do it in Capitals red, white, and blue.
